The STP4953A is a state-of-the-art power transistor from STMicroelectronics, a global leader in semiconductor solutions. This device is designed to cater to a wide range of applications that require high efficiency and reliability in power conversion and management.
Key Features
- High Voltage Capability: The STP4953A is capable of handling high voltages, making it suitable for various industrial and consumer applications where voltage spikes are common.
- Low On-Resistance: With its low on-resistance, this power transistor ensures minimal power loss during operation, leading to increased efficiency in electronic circuits.
- Fast Switching Speed: The device boasts a fast switching speed, which is essential for applications that require quick response times and high-frequency operation.
- High Current Handling: Designed to manage high current levels, the STP4953A is an excellent choice for power-intensive applications.
- Robust Thermal Performance: The power transistor comes with superior thermal characteristics, ensuring it operates reliably even under high temperature conditions.
Applications
The STP4953A is highly versatile and can be used in various applications, including:
- Switch Mode Power Supplies (SMPS)
- Motor Control Circuits
- LED Lighting Systems
- DC-DC Converters
- Automotive Electronics
- Renewable Energy Systems
